Nice little baboush (Moroccan snail soup) place. A small bowl is 10 dh and a big bowl is 20 dh and you get a cup of broth too. It was yummy and warming and the man serving us was very friendly. Price per person: MAD 1–50 Food: 4 Service: 4 Atmosphere: 5
